In a recent symposium on nuclear technology, leading experts in the field have come to a consensus that the integration of artificial intelligence with nuclear weapons is inevitable.
The use of AI in nuclear weapons systems has the potential to revolutionize the way wars are fought and could lead to a new era of warfare.
While there are concerns about the ethical implications of using AI in such a destructive manner, experts argue that the benefits outweigh the risks.
AI could enhance the accuracy and efficiency of nuclear weapons, potentially reducing collateral damage and civilian casualties in the event of a conflict.
However, there are also fears that the use of AI in nuclear weapons could lead to a lack of human control and decision-making, raising concerns about the potential for unintended consequences.
Despite these risks, experts believe that the integration of AI with nuclear weapons is inevitable and that it is crucial for governments to regulate and monitor its use to prevent potential disasters.
As the technology continues to advance, it is becoming increasingly important for policymakers to address the ethical and security concerns surrounding the use of AI in nuclear weapons systems.
Ultimately, the decision to mix AI and nuclear weapons rests in the hands of world leaders, who must carefully consider the implications of such a powerful combination.
